PI
NPOINT TEST D : DTC P0
569; SPEED CONTROL DECEL/SET- SWITCH ON FAULT
WARN
ING: Where tests involve the removal of the steering
wheel, and/or disconnection of air bag connectors, the
procedure for disarming air bags must be followed,
REFER to: Air Bag Supplemental Re straint System (SRS)
(50
1-20B Supplemental Restra
int System, Description and
Operation).
TE S
T
CONDITIONS
D E
TAILS/RESULTS/ACTIONS
D1: CHECK
THE SPEED CONTROL SWITCHPACK IN
TERNAL CIRCUITS FOR SHORT TO GROUND
Disc
onnect the speed control switch
pack electrical connector, SW02.
1
Measure t
he resistance between SW
02, pin 06 (BO) and GROUND.
2
Measure t
he resistance between SW
02, pin 04 (SR) and GROUND.
3
Is either resistance le
ss than 10,000 ohms?
Yes REPAIR the short circuit. For addi tional information, refer to the wiring diagrams. CLEAR the DTC.
TEST the system for normal operation.
No GO to D2
.
D2: CHECK
THE SPEED CONTROL CASSE
TTE REEL FOR SHORT TO GROUND
Me
asure the resistance between SW02, pin 06 (at the cassette reel side of the connector) and
GROUND.
1
M e
asure the resistance between SW02, pin 04 (at the cassette reel side of the connector) and
GROUND.
2
Is either resi stance le
ss than 10,000 ohms?
Yes REPAIR the short circuit. For addi tional information, refer to the wiring diagrams. CLEAR the DTC.
TEST the system for normal operation.
No GO to D3
.
D3: CHECK
THE SPEED CONTROL DECEL/SET- SWITCH ACTION
Meas
ure t
he resistance between SW02,
pin 06 (BO) and SW02, pin 04 (SR).
1
Operate
the speed control
DECEL/SET- switch.
2
Do
es the resistance
vary by 680 ohms?
Yes Recheck DTCs. No short found. Po ssible intermittent fault. CLEAR the DTC. TEST the system for
normal operation.
No INSTALL a new speed control switchpack. CLEAR the DTC. TEST the system for normal operation.
PINPOI
NT TEST E : DTC P0570; SPEED CONTROL "ACCEL/SET+" SWITCH "ON" FAULT
WAR
N
ING: Where tests involve the removal of the steering
wheel, and/or disconnection of air bag connectors, the
procedure for disarming air bags must be followed,
REFER to: Air Bag Supplemental Re straint System (SRS)
(50
1-20B Supplemental Restra
int System, Description and
Operation).
TE S
T
CONDITIONS
D E
TAILS/RESULTS/ACTIONS
E1
: CHECK THE SPEED CONTROL
SWITCHPACK IN
TERNAL CIRCUITS FOR SHORT TO GROUND

Di
sconnect the speed control switch
pack electrical connector, SW02.
1
Meas
ure the resistance between SW
02, pin 06 (BO) and GROUND.
2
Meas
ure the resistance between SW
02, pin 04 (SR) and GROUND.
3
Is either resi
stance
less than 10,000 ohms?
Yes REPAIR the short circuit. For addi tional information, refer to the wiring diagrams. CLEAR the DTC.
TEST the system for normal operation.
No GO to E2
.
E2
: CHECK THE SPEED CONTROL CASSE
TTE REEL FOR SHORT TO GROUND
M
easure the resistance between SW02, pin 06 (at the cassette reel side of the connector) and
GROUND.
1
M
easure the resistance between SW02, pin 04 (at the cassette reel side of the connector) and
GROUND.
2
Is either resi
stance
less than 10,000 ohms?
Yes REPAIR the short circuit. For addi tional information, refer to the wiring diagrams. CLEAR the DTC.
TEST the system for normal operation.
No GO to E3
.
E3
: CHECK THE SPEED CONTROL
ACCEL/SET+ SWITCH ACTION
Meas
ure the resistance between SW02,
pin 06 (BO) and SW02, pin 04 (SR).
1
Op
erate the cruise control
ACCEL/SET+ switch.
2
D
oes the resistance
vary by 430 ohms?
Yes Recheck DTCs. No short found. Po ssible intermittent fault. CLEAR the DTC. TEST the system for
normal operation.
No INSTALL a new speed control switchpack. CLEAR the DTC. TEST the system for normal operation.
